During the summer, you will have an opportunity to learn about the following:
Design and construction of:
Aggregate Piers
Rigid Inclusions
Ductile Iron Pipe Piles
Micro Piles
Support of Excavation (SOE) systems
Design-Build project lifecycle including:
Project lead generation
Bid/proposal development
Development of design calculation packages and construction drawings
Project management through execution of construction
Development of soft skills including industry networking, communication practices
Our Intern’s Essential Roles and Responsibilities:
Perform assignments requiring application of standard techniques, procedures and criteria to carry out engineering tasks
Exercise judgment limited to developing details of work in making preliminary selections and adaptations of engineering alternatives
Prepare engineering related calculations, develop drawings and visual aids
Perform geotechnical design and analyses under the supervision of a Professional Engineer for shallow and deep foundations, settlement, slope stability
